Output 23596ca0a647d1362c71c753421d04bf553eec1033b10825fcd38be93f1af346:1

value
19657093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0328c1c58a599a9bfa3ea0468b31f9b9707abd69 OP_EQUAL
address
M8Bs5r2jYRDufFGZSWxZK4cYZx2CxPB1dg
transaction
23596ca0a647d1362c71c753421d04bf553eec1033b10825fcd38be93f1af346
spent
true